Abstract
A latex glove soaking, washing and drying integrated machine, comprising a machine body housing (1), a machine body base (2), an external air discharge pipe frame (3), an outer cylinder (4), a driving mechanism (5), an inner rotating drum (6), an air discharge pipe (7) and a fan (8); the driving mechanism further comprises a mounting frame (51), a driving motor (52), a transmission shaft sleeve (53), a transmission shaft (54) and a transmission component (55); and the mounting frame is composed of an upper mounting plate (511), a lower mounting plate (512) and a support rod located therebetween. Compared with the prior art, the integrated machine has a simple structure, is reasonably designed, and integrates the described multiple processes into one. Dewatering can be performed at a low speed after washing and vulcanization, which not only saves a vulcanization solution, but also improves the precision of the process; there is no need to transfer materials, for drying, and during the final discharging, the machine can be tilted forward to automatically perform discharging.

乳胶手套在其模具成型后,需要清洗、硫化、干燥等工序。以往,清洗、硫化在类似一个大锅的容腔内敞开作业,然后,人工将乳胶手套放入脱水机脱水,再又人工放入烘干机烘干。作业过程不仅费水、费液,周期长,而且工人的劳动强度特别的大,工作环境也及其恶劣,因此,有必要提出一种乳胶手套泡洗烘一体机。After the latex gloves are formed in the mold, they need to be cleaned, vulcanized, and dried. In the past, cleaning and vulcanization were performed in an open cavity similar to a large pot. Then, the latex gloves were manually put into a dehydrator for dehydration, and then manually placed in a dryer for drying. The operation process not only consumes water and liquid, but also has a long cycle, and the labor intensity of the workers is particularly high, and the working environment is also extremely harsh. Therefore, it is necessary to propose an all-in-one latex gloves washing and drying machine.

本发明的工作过程:The working process of the present invention:
本发明一种乳胶手套泡洗烘一体机在工作过程中,可以先将外门41和转笼内门64打开,然后将待加工的乳胶手套置于内转笼6内部,然后关上外门41和转笼内门64,然后根据工序要求通过接口板11上的接头向外缸4内部通入物质(蒸汽、冷水、工艺溶液、热水等),启动驱动电机52带动传动轴54从而带动内转笼6旋转,乳胶手套与通入物质完全接触,充分搅拌后,打开排水阀门43,将通入物质排出,然后启动烘干加热器42和风机8,对内转笼6内部的乳胶手套进行烘干,带有水汽的热气流沿着排风管7和外接排风管31排放,当乳胶手套完全干燥后,关闭烘干加热器42和风机8,打开外门41和转笼内门64,启动倾斜装置21,将机体外壳1抬起,机体外壳1在旋转连杆22的限位作用下,向前倾斜,同时风机8与外接排风管31相互分离,在重力作用下将加工完成的乳胶手套自动排出。During the working process of the integrated latex gloves washing and drying machine of the present invention, the outer door 41 and the inner door 64 of the rotating cage can be opened first, then the latex gloves to be processed are placed inside the inner rotating cage 6, and then the outer door 41 can be closed. and the inner door 64 of the rotating cage, and then according to the process requirements, the material (steam, cold water, process solution, hot water, etc.) is introduced into the outer cylinder 4 through the joint on the interface board 11, and the driving motor 52 is started to drive the transmission shaft 54 to drive the inner The rotating cage 6 rotates, and the latex gloves are in complete contact with the introduced material. After fully stirring, the drainage valve 43 is opened to discharge the introduced material, and then the drying heater 42 and the fan 8 are started to perform the operation on the latex gloves inside the inner rotating cage 6. When drying, the hot air with water vapor is discharged along the exhaust duct 7 and the external exhaust duct 31. When the latex gloves are completely dried, turn off the drying heater 42 and the fan 8, and open the outer door 41 and the inner door 64 of the tumbler. , start the tilting device 21, lift the body shell 1, the body shell 1 is tilted forward under the limiting action of the rotating connecting rod 22, and the fan 8 and the external exhaust pipe 31 are separated from each other, and the processing is completed under the action of gravity The latex gloves automatically drain.
